Output e5343a269430880d90b59542c843c67fc27a6a3197e71eaba5c41d85d203e083:1

value
28598152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 785a0413e1c88a2d7ebdfa30feda1f12a336a074 OP_EQUALVERIFY OP_CHECKSIG
address
1ByMvSHi3tgeixf9Sgey4jFP4ZoJvauT92
transaction
e5343a269430880d90b59542c843c67fc27a6a3197e71eaba5c41d85d203e083
spent
true